Web9 jun. 2024 · I am trying to use Python to split a string field into three new fields at the separator " - ". The field is in the format "a - b - c". So I initially had this in the field calculator for newFieldA: !myField!.partition (" - ") [0] This gave me the value a in newFieldA. Similarly, I calculated newFieldB and newFieldC.
